The above statement is True.
Noise pollution adversely affects the lives of countless humans. Studies have shown that there are unit direct links between noise and health. The foremost common ill health it causes is Noise-induced hearing impairment (NIHL). Exposure to clap may also cause high-pressure levels, cardiovascular disease, sleep disturbances, and stress. In addition, noise pollution triggers reactions in the body, including the secretion of certain hormones such as adrenaline and cortisol. These reactions account for the development of heart and cardiovascular diseases after many years of noise exposure.
